Common issues include premature brake wear from winter road salt and potholes, along with electrical problems in infotainment systems. The variable Midwest climate also stresses suspension components and can lead to oil leaks from engine seals over time, making regular undercarriage inspections wise.

For routine maintenance, oil changes, brake service, and most suspension work, a qualified local shop is perfectly capable. For very specific recalls, advanced transmission issues, or proprietary hybrid system diagnostics, you may need the specialized scan tools only available at an Acura dealership, which would require a trip to Fort Wayne or Indianapolis.
